Whetstone, AZ vs Wilhoit, AZ
Whetstone, AZ and Wilhoit, AZ have a very similar cost of living, with only a 4.1% difference in their overall index. Whetstone scores 79 while Wilhoit scores 76 on the cost of living index, where 100 represents the national average. The day-to-day expenses for residents in both cities are comparable, though differences emerge when looking at specific categories.
On the housing front, median rent in Whetstone is $1,057/month compared to $855/month in Wilhoit — a 24% difference. Interestingly, home values tell a different story: while Wilhoit has cheaper rent, Whetstone actually has lower median home values ($200,600 vs $201,600).
Median household income in Whetstone is $51,050 compared to $48,542 in Wilhoit (+5.2%). While Whetstone is more expensive, its higher salaries more than compensate — residents there may actually end up with more disposable income. Looking at affordability, residents of Whetstone spend roughly 24.8% of their income on rent, more than the 21.1% in Wilhoit.
